Lee Nearlys Triples While Eliminating 1978 WSOP Main Event Champ

Level 18 : 15,000/30,000, 5,000 ante
Bobby Baldwin
Bobby Baldwin

Chris Lee opened for 60,000 in early position and was met by a three-bet to 135,000 by Eugene Katchalov on the button. Bobby Baldwin, who won the World Series of Poker way back in 1978, then shoved all in for 315,000 from the big blind. Lee moved all in over the top for 525,000 or so and Katchalov called to put both of them at risk.

Katchalov: {a-Clubs}{a-Spades}
Baldwin: {a-Hearts}{q-Spades}
Lee: {k-Spades}{k-Diamonds}

Baldwin was in bad shape, and so was Lee as Katchalov had the granddaddy of all hands. Fortunately for Lee, he would receive a reprieve when the {3-Diamonds}{k-Clubs}{7-Spades} flop delivered him a set. The {8-Clubs} turn and {10-Spades} river failed to change anything, and Lee nearly tripled while Baldwin was sent to the rail.
